ASP.NET+SQLserver鲜花订购系统设计+源代码(5)
时间:2023-12-09 20:34 来源:毕业论文 作者:毕业论文 点击:次
1。前台设计 前台作为是与用户直接交互的界面,应该设计时候考虑简洁性和色彩鲜艳性能够体现出鲜花的美丽,一眼吸引用户的眼球。 前台主要功能包括:注册/登录、购物车、鲜花查询、鲜花分类浏览、最新公告、热销产品展示功能等等。 2。前台设计的特色 (1) 购物车 每个注册的用户,都可以自由地查看购物车中订购的鲜花。界面尽量做的简捷,方便客户轻松掌控自已的信息。 购买鲜花的详细过程 具体流程为: 会员注册/登陆—>挑选鲜花—>购物车—>提交订单—>网上付款—>支付成功。 (3)灵活产品展示区论文网 网站前台几种方式显视栏目: 新品上市、热销产品、销售排行榜、本周主打产品 (4) 详细的用户帮助信息 包括常见问题、付款说明、配送说明、服务保证等信息。 3。后台设计 本系统在设计后台上尽可量提供简明简易操作的方式,供管理员方便操作,常用操作中包括:发布新闻、新闻管理、广告图片上传、鲜花分类站内信息管理、付款及配送方式管理,除此之外包括鲜花添加、鲜花管理、订单管理、访问主页等。 下面简单地介绍几个重要的模块 1。用户管理模块,系统管理员可以添加或删除用户信息 2。图片管理模块,主要实现的是鲜花图片及广告相关图片的添加和删除。 3。鲜花信息管理模板,是用来添加或删除鲜花信息,也可对鲜花资料进行修改。 4。订单管理模块,主要实现的是对订单信息的审核,添加了增删修改订单的功能。 4。3系统功能模块设计 本系统为开发者提供一个形象而明确的思路。本系统主要由前台和后台组成。前台设计的主要模块有:商品展示、商品查询、用户登录、用户注册、购物车、收银台等;后台设计的主要模块有:商品信息管理、商品分类管理、订单管理、用户信息管理等。 4。4 数据库设计 4。4。1 数据库需求分析 在网上鲜花订购系统中,数据库应当保存如下信息。 1。注册用户的个人信息资料。 2。鲜花信息,包括花名、价格、包装等信息。 3。购物车的详细信息。 4。订单信息,包括日期、发送地址、是否付款等。 4。4。2数据库概念设计 概念设计阶段是整个数据库设计的关键。在设计的时候先根据需求所对应的每个应用的E-R 图,这其中包括实体、属性和联系。 网上鲜花订购系统的实体关系如图所示。 图4-1 实体关系图 1。会员实体关系模式:会员(用户ID,用户名,真实姓名,密码,电子邮箱,联系地址,手机号码) 。主键:用户ID。文献综述 2。鲜花实体关系模式说明:鲜花(鲜花ID,编号,鲜花名称,库存数量,单价,材料,包装方式)。主键:鲜花ID。 3。订单实体关系模式说明:订单(用户ID,鲜花ID,收货人姓名,收货人电话,收货人地址,收货人邮箱,订货人姓名,订货人电话,订购总额,订购数量,备注,订单状态,确认时间,发货时间) 。主键:用户ID外键:鲜花ID。 4。管理员实体关系模式说明:管理员(管理员ID,管理员名称,密码) 。主键:管理员ID。 4。4。3数据库逻辑设计 数据库的概念结构设计完后,根据系统各功能模块,建立相应的数据表,也就是数据库的逻辑结构,如管理员表、用户信息表、订单表、购物车表、鲜花表等。如图6所示 (责任编辑:qin) |